Chicken Marsala Recipe

Ingredients:

1 1/2 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ts

Salt and pepper
2 Tbsp EVOO
5 Tbsp butter
3/4 cup chopped onion
1 lb baby bellas, sliced
2 Tbsp minced garlic
1 cup Marsala wine
1/2 cup mascarpone cheese
2 tsp Dijon mustard (not honey dijon)
2 Tbsp fresh chopped Italian parsley
Fettuccine

Directions:

Season chicken with salt and pepper. Cook chicken in oil 4 minutes per side. Remove from pan.

Melt 2 Tbsp butter in same pan over medium-high heat. Add the onion and cook 2 minutes. Add mushrooms and garlic and saute until the juices evaporate about 12 minutes.

Add the marsala wine. Simmer until reduced by half about 4 minutes. Stir in mascarpone and mustard. Return chicken to pan. Simmer, uncovered, about 2 minutes. Stir in chopped parsley. Season to taste with salt and pepper.

Cook pasta and serve.
